integrated development

1) one developer
2) balanced development: 1 portion company can do worse in
business because another can support it.
3)rapid development
4) functional form: cohesive theme/optimal layout
5) isolation
6) high priced: First class all aspects

catalytic development : developer encourages complementary
development

1) centralized development: the developer provides
infrastructure for other facilities
2) secondary developers: after the initial success of the resort;
movies, nightclubs, shops, etc. are built
3) interdependency: if initial resort fails the other business will
too

coattail development: usually around national parks, historic
sites, etc

Example: Moab Utah

1) no common theme:
2) duplication and redundancy
3) greater competition: increase business raise competition

,4) lack of planning and control
